#208 Build problems

head
closed
nobody
None
5
2014-07-25
2014-04-03
owo
No

commit 02a0ab41399ce94753e94d1a2229e43d09370463
Author: Dan Dennedy dan@dennedy.org
Date: Wed Apr 2 23:11:19 2014 -0700

./configure --enable-gpl --enable-gpl3 --enable-motion_est --avformat-swscale --luma-compress --swig-languages=python --disable-swfdec --disable-jackrack

Configuring framework:
src/melt/mlt/src/framework
Configuring modules:
src/melt/mlt/src/modules
Configuring modules/avformat:
src/melt/mlt/src/modules/avformat
Configuring modules/core:
Configuring modules/decklink:
Configuring modules/dv:
src/melt/mlt/src/modules/dv
Configuring modules/feeds:
Configuring modules/frei0r:
src/melt/mlt/src/modules/frei0r
Configuring modules/gtk2:
src/melt/mlt/src/modules/gtk2
- Libexif found, enabling auto rotate
Configuring modules/kdenlive:
Configuring modules/kino:
src/melt/mlt/src/modules/kino
Configuring modules/linsys:
src/melt/mlt/src/modules/linsys
Configuring modules/lumas:
src/melt/mlt/src/modules/lumas
Configuring modules/motion_est:
Configuring modules/normalize:
Configuring modules/oldfilm:
Configuring modules/opengl:
src/melt/mlt/src/modules/opengl
Configuring modules/plus:
Configuring modules/plusgpl:
Configuring modules/qt:
src/melt/mlt/src/modules/qt
- Libexif found, enabling auto rotate
- Qt version 4.x detected
Configuring modules/resample:
src/melt/mlt/src/modules/resample
Configuring modules/rtaudio:
src/melt/mlt/src/modules/rtaudio
Configuring modules/sdl:
src/melt/mlt/src/modules/sdl
Configuring modules/sox:
src/melt/mlt/src/modules/sox
Configuring modules/videostab:
Configuring modules/vid.stab:
src/melt/mlt/src/modules/vid.stab
Configuring modules/vmfx:
Configuring modules/vorbis:
src/melt/mlt/src/modules/vorbis
Configuring modules/xine:
Configuring modules/xml:
src/melt/mlt/src/modules/xml
Configuring mlt++:
src/melt/mlt/src/mlt++
Configuring swig:
src/melt/mlt/src/swig
GPLv3 license used

[…]
make[1]: Leaving directory src/melt/mlt/src/framework' make[1]: Entering directorysrc/melt/mlt/src/mlt++'
/usr/bin/g++ -shared -Wl,-soname,libmlt++.so.3 -o libmlt++.so.0.9.1 MltConsumer.o MltDeque.o MltEvent.o MltFactory.o MltField.o MltFilter.o MltFilteredConsumer.o MltFilteredProducer.o MltFrame.o MltGeometry.o MltMultitrack.o MltParser.o MltPlaylist.o MltProducer.o MltProfile.o MltProperties.o MltPushConsumer.o MltRepository.o MltService.o MltTokeniser.o MltTractor.o MltTransition.o -L/usr/local/lib -L/usr/local/lib -Wl,--no-undefined -Wl,--as-needed -Wl,--no-undefined -Wl,--as-needed -L../framework -lmlt -Wl,--version-script=mlt++.vers
MltPlaylist.o: In function Mlt::Playlist::mix_in(int, int)': MltPlaylist.cpp:(.text+0x88e): undefined reference tomlt_playlist_mix_in'
MltPlaylist.o: In function Mlt::Playlist::mix_out(int, int)': MltPlaylist.cpp:(.text+0x8be): undefined reference tomlt_playlist_mix_out'
collect2: error: ld returned 1 exit status
make[1]: [libmlt++.so.0.9.1] Fehler 1
make[1]: Leaving directory `src/melt/mlt/src/mlt++'
make:
[all] Fehler 1

Discussion

  • Dan Dennedy
    Dan Dennedy
    2014-04-03

    It is seeing your installed mlt headers before the ones in the source tree. You can either uninstall mlt from /usr (package?) or "make -C src/framework install" before compiling the rest. With that said, build support is not provided and this ticket closing.

     
  • Dan Dennedy
    Dan Dennedy
    2014-04-03

    • status: open --> closed